LINUX.ORG.RU
ФорумAdmin

Mikrotik, OSPF, 2 Канала в одну точку

 , ,


0

1

Ситуация простая, есть два роутера, на одном(M1) два канала в интернет, у второго(M2) один канал. С M2 на M1 прокинуто два L2tp/Ipsec соединения(по одному на каждый интернет канал). Настроил OSPF, для основного канала(C1) cost: 10, для резервного(C2) cost: 40. Одна зона: backbone.

И если одновременно работают оба канала, то OSPF странно выстраивает маршруты. От M1 маршрут идет по C1. От M2 маршрут идет по C2. Соответственно каналы работают одновременно в полудюплексном режиме и у конечных пользователей начинают возникать непонятные проблемы(вроде зависаний сессий в 1с и шипений в телефонии). Если один из каналов отключить, то все работает как требуется, но теряется изначальная задумка внедрение OSPF: автоматическое переключение каналов. Что можно подкрутить что-бы соединения не разрывались на все доступные каналы?

Иллюстрация

Deleted

Последнее исправление: Nomonok (всего исправлений: 1)

Поверх L2TP/IPsec построй 2 EOIP, их заверни в бондинг и будет счастье. OSPF в твоем случае не нужон.

Turbid ★★★★★
()
Ответ на: комментарий от Turbid

Это упрощенная схема, на самом деле 40 региональных роутеров и пара центральных, у регоинальных по одному-два канала до каждого из центральных, так что ну нафиг этот ваш eoip.

Deleted
()
Ответ на: комментарий от Deleted

Очень зря, у нас топология - большая звезда, все филиалы подключены через бондинги с 2-3 каналами, а ospf уже ходит поверх них, так получается не только резервирование, но агрегация и балансировка.

По теме - вангую что у тебя где-то обратный маршрут не через тот канал. Как разруливаеются два оператора на одном микротике? Маркировку настроил?

Turbid ★★★★★
()
Ответ на: комментарий от Turbid

Как разруливаеются два оператора на одном микротике? Маркировку настроил?

2 маршрута с разной дистанцией, pbr для исходящего трафика(плюс два маршрута с метками) и для входящего трафика wayback настроен.

Deleted
()

а есть cost увеличить/уменьшить? честно не помню сколько ставил сам, но был фул-меш поверх IPsec+GRE, с резервированием каналов разумеется, все норм работало

upcFrost ★★★★★
()
Последнее исправление: upcFrost (всего исправлений: 1)
Ответ на: комментарий от upcFrost

Где уменьшить? На динамических маршрутах(которых ospf создает) им рулить нельзя. На статических нет смысла.

Deleted
()
Ответ на: комментарий от Deleted

Cost настроен как надо(на иллюстрации он есть), но ospf игнорирует

вот это уже интереснее. кстати, а оно норм работает когда адрес mkt2 один и тот же?

upcFrost ★★★★★
()
Ответ на: комментарий от upcFrost

Действительно интересно, назначил на mkt2 для второго канала 10.10.10.2 и стало работать как требуется.

Deleted
()
Ответ на: комментарий от Deleted

если честно иллюстрацию изначально не смотрел, потому сразу не сказал. у меня оно работало потому что было поверх GRE и IPsec, и там с адресами все было пучком.

upcFrost 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.